Output 687af65928089671f23a16417b75c7184d1e45fccc3b7ff117f2ad4f91910a58:2

value
88795
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4307e570abdf84ad4348ba80c9f290f0d79e4352 OP_EQUALVERIFY OP_CHECKSIG
address
177RjVdwYRyk9TZjQNoqkkuxwzaEkH3RFX
transaction
687af65928089671f23a16417b75c7184d1e45fccc3b7ff117f2ad4f91910a58
spent
true